The Role of a Professional Door Technician

Professional door technicians are concentrated on the setup, maintenance, and repair of different kinds of doors, locks, and gain access to control systems. Their role is multifaceted and extends beyond just fixing broken doors. Here are some of the essential obligations of a professional door technician:

Installation and Setup

  • Installing new doors, locks, and hardware in property, business, and commercial settings.
  • Establishing gain access to control systems, consisting of electronic locks and keycard readers.
  • Ensuring that all installations fulfill security and security requirements.

Repair and maintenance

  • Frequently examining and keeping doors and locks to prevent concerns.
  • Repairing broken or malfunctioning doors, hinges, and locks.
  • Fixing and solving concerns with access control systems.

Security Assessments

  • Performing security assessments to determine vulnerabilities in a structure's gain access to points.
  • Recommending and implementing security upgrades, such as setting up high-security locks or enhancing door frames.

Customer care

  • Supplying exceptional customer service by communicating effectively with customers.
  • Providing advice and assistance on door and lock maintenance.
  • Making sure that customers are pleased with the service offered.

Compliance and Safety

  • Ensuring that all work complies with regional building codes and regulations.
  • Complying with safety procedures to avoid accidents and injuries.

Abilities and Qualifications

To stand out as a professional door service technician, one should possess a combination of technical abilities, physical abilities, and social qualities. Here are a few of the necessary skills and qualifications:

  • Technical Expertise: A deep understanding of door and lock mechanisms, as well as experience with different kinds of gain access to control systems.
  • Problem-Solving Skills: The ability to diagnose and solve complex issues effectively.
  • Physical Stamina: The task frequently includes lifting heavy doors, working in tight spaces, and standing for extended periods.
  • Attention to Detail: Precision is important when installing or fixing locks and hardware.
  • Client Service Skills: Effective interaction and the capability to work well with customers.
  • Accreditations: Many door technicians hold accreditations from professional companies, such as the Door and Hardware Institute (DHI).

The Importance of Professional Door Technicians

The work of professional door technicians is crucial for a number of factors:

Safety and Security

  • Well-kept doors and locks are vital for the safety and security of buildings and their residents.
  • Professional technicians ensure that gain access to control systems are functioning correctly, preventing unauthorized entry.

Accessibility

  • Doors that open and close efficiently are essential for ease of access, particularly in public structures and those with high foot traffic.
  • Technicians guarantee that doors satisfy ADA (Americans with Disabilities Act) standards, making them available to all users.

Energy Efficiency

  • Correctly set up and kept doors assist to reduce energy usage by preventing air leakages.
  • This can cause lower energy bills and a more sustainable building environment.

Expense Savings

  • Regular maintenance and timely repairs can extend the life-span of doors and locks, decreasing the need for pricey replacements.
  • Professional technicians can identify possible problems before they become major problems, conserving customers cash in the long run.

Q: What are the most typical kinds of doors and locks that door technicians work with?A: Door technicians work with a variety of doors and locks, consisting of:

  • Residential doors and locks (e.g., deadbolts, lever manages)
  • Commercial doors and locks (e.g., exit gadgets, panic bars)
  • Industrial doors and locks (e.g., high-security locks, electronic access control systems)
  • Specialized doors (e.g., fire-rated doors, automated moving doors)

Q: How can I become a professional door service technician?A: To end up being a professional door professional, you can follow these actions:

  • Complete a high school diploma or equivalent.
  • Enroll in a trade school or professional program that offers courses in door and lock setup and repair.
  • Gain hands-on experience through an apprenticeship or entry-level position.
  • Think about acquiring certifications from professional companies like the Door and Hardware Institute (DHI).

Q: What tools do professional door technicians utilize?A: Professional door technicians use a range of tools, consisting of:

  • Screwdrivers, wrenches, and pliers
  • Lock picks and tension wrenches
  • Power tools (e.g., drills, saws)
  • Measuring tools (e.g., measuring tape, calipers)
  • Diagnostic equipment for electronic gain access to control systems
